Minimum 40% of NPS corpus must be used to purchase an annuity at retirement. Remaining 60% is tax-free lumpsum. Estimated pension assumes ~6% annuity rate p.a.

First Rs.20 Lakh of gratuity is tax-exempt. Amount above Rs.20L taxed at your retirement slab. Formula: (Last Salary × 15 × Years) / 26.
